Freeze you card at a minimum. Test charges are often lower in the hope you don’t notice it. Anything Russian is a red flag. Even had a charity do a dollar test charge. Err on side of caution

A good protection option is to active the card security option to automatically be notified (by text) if your card is used for an online transaction.
That way you can lock the card immediately if used by a scammer. Make sure you are aware of all online transactions you or your spouse makes so you don’t lock the card unnecessarily… |
